Europe and America: Where are we and where are we going?

Speaker Rose Gottemoeller, Catherine A. Novelli, Ronald E. Neumann, John R. Beyrle

Speakers photos Speakers photos
Speakers photos
Ambassadors Forum, presented by the Weiser Diplomacy Center (WDC) in partnership with the American Academy of Diplomacy, and co-sponsored by the Weiser Center for Europe and Eurasia (WCEE)

About the Event:

Since the end of World War II, the United States and Europe have been closely tied together. American security ties with Europe were a fundamental part of overall US security during the Cold War. Europe is the United States’ largest trading partner. The development of Europe after the war has been, and continues to be, a key part of America's prosperity for 70 years. Are things changing now? What will the security relationship between the US and Europe look like going forward? What is Russia's place? How will the US balance its relations between Russia and Europe? The Ambassadors Forum will tackle some of the most central issues in this paradigm.
